What are handheld showers?

Handheld showers are an invaluable addition to the modern bathroom. They consist of a showerhead attached to a hose, allowing for easy manipulation of the spray for different functions. Handheld showers offer numerous benefits, such as increased flexibility for both children and seniors, allowing users to adjust the spray for different purposes.

Most handheld showerheads have an adjustable spray pattern that can be increased or decreased for their specific needs. Some even have separate settings for a shower massage. They are also better for the environment, conserving water and energy.

Furthermore, many handheld showers come with adjustable height settings, allowing users to find a comfortable height for use. They are easy to install, and by providing easy access to all parts of the body, they offer more complete coverage.

The adjustable nature of the handheld showerhead makes it especially useful in homes with young children or aging parents. Its convenience and versatility make it an essential bathroom fixture.

What are the different types of shower heads?

There are a variety of different types of shower heads available on the market today. These shower head types can be divided into two main categories – fixed heads and hand-held showers.

Fixed shower heads are the most common type of shower head and are permanently connected to a shower pipe with no option for the user to change the angle or direction of the water spray. Fixed showerheads come in a range of shapes and sizes and can provide a luxurious rainfall effect or a powerful massaging spray.

These heads are usually installed at the wall or ceiling and can sit flush with the wall/ceiling or they can be attached to an overhead arm.

Hand-held showers are the second type of shower head available. These shower heads are attached to the wall or ceiling by a flexible hose so the user can manually adjust the angle and direction of the water spray.

The added flexibility that a hand-held shower provides makes them ideal for those with mobility issues, as they can be used while sitting on a bath seat. Hand-held showers also have added convenience when bathing children as you can easily adjust the angle and direction of the water spray to clean those hard to reach body parts.

In addition to these two shower head categories there are a range of other specialty types available which provide additional features such as temperature control, lighting, and body jets. These specialty shower heads offer the user more levels of customization and luxury, however, they are much more expensive than fixed and hand-held shower heads.

Why should you replace your shower head?

It is important to replace your shower head periodically to ensure your bathroom stays clean, safe and functioning properly. Most shower heads need to be replaced every few years to prevent clogging, corrosion and mineral build up.

As the material in shower heads tends to deteriorate and decay with age, the water pressure may decrease or the jets may start to shoot out in the wrong direction, making the showering experience unpleasant.

Additionally, with an old shower head, minerals and sediments can build up and start to reduce water flow. This in turn will lead to water wastage, resulting in a much higher water bill. Furthermore, unclean, clogged shower heads often emit mildew which can cause mould, health issues and unpleasant odours.

How can I improve the water pressure in my shower?

Improving the water pressure in your shower can be done in a few ways. First, you should check any shut-off valves that lead to the shower and make sure they are fully open. If you have a shower with separate hot and cold controls, you should check the balance between the two valves – if the cold valve is open too much it can lower the pressure on the hot side.

You can also check for clogged pipes or sediment in the shower head, which can reduce the flow of water. Finally, if you have old or outdated pipes that may be too narrow to have good pressure, you can have them replaced by a plumbing professional with wider pipes.
